WEB2763/26 is a planning application for permission at 4, Albert Place East, Dublin 2 D02 PP74, received by Dublin City Council on 16 Jul 2026 and first seen by Planning Register on 11 Sept 2026. The application describes: the demolition of the existing single-storey and two-storey extensions to rear of existing dwelling and the construction of a replacement stepped three-storey rear extension, including attic-level accommodation to rear of existing dwelling, together with all associated site development works. No decision has been made yet; the council's decision is due by 9 Sept 2026. The five-week observation window closed on 20 Aug 2026. Zoning at the site
Zone Z2 - DEV PLAN 2022-2028
Z2: Residential Neighbourhoods (Conservation Areas): To protect and/or improve the amenities of residential conservation areas.
An established residential area. The objective is to protect existing residential amenity as well as to provide housing — which is the objective a neighbour's objection to an overbearing extension is usually argued under.
